Harvard makes use of multiple rating scales within their organization, including overall performance ratings of employees, goals, competencies, and direct report ratings. Overall performance ratings are given on a 5-point scale, observing employees with performances that are: 5 = Leading. 4 = Strong. 3 = Solid.

This is especially true ... cost of capital equitypsychological damage of wearing masks Jul 21, 2022 · The 360-degree evaluation is a multidimensional work performance review method. It assesses an employee using feedback gathered from the employee's circle of influence, such as direct reports, customers, coworkers and managers.
